**Runbook — Telemetry payload compression (Signalbarn ingest)**

Before enabling compression on a new device cohort, confirm the ingest gateway advertises the matching codec; mismatches cause silent drops, not errors. Enable in shadow mode first, compare payload counts against the uncompressed stream for 24 hours, then promote. Never change the compression level and the codec in the same release. Record the gateway build you validated against, noted directly below.

build token for fajof-yahof: htk4_869f

Quarterly Planning Note — Pilot Churn, Fenwick Programme

Finance: churn in the Fenwick pilot hit 14% this quarter, above the 9% threshold. Main driver is onboarding friction, not pricing. Orla's team is reworking the setup flow; revised retention targets due in three weeks. Hold further pilot spend until then. Budget impact is modest but real — model it into Q4. The commercial reasoning behind this pause is in the confidential note below.

confidential, kagep-kahof: Druokax Systems plans to lower the Ulaath list price by 53 percent in March.

### v3.2.0 — Setting renamed

Heads up, plugin authors: the Dustpan retention sweeper no longer reads SWEEP_AUTH. That name caused endless confusion with SWEEP_AUTO, so we've renamed it to SWEEPER_REGISTRY_CREDENTIAL. The old name still works until v3.4 but logs a deprecation warning on every run. Update your plugin manifests and any env files you ship. A typical `.env` now declares the sweeper's registry credential on the line that follows.

vault entry, yahif-yajep: COURIER_KEY29=b802bdf8034096b65a51c6ba5abe2

## Changelog — Synclade 4.2: New conflict-resolution defaults

Plugin authors, please note: Synclade's calendar sync now defaults to last-writer-wins with a tiebreak on event origin, replacing the older merge-both behavior that produced duplicate events under concurrent edits. Plugins relying on the duplicate-and-merge pattern must opt back in explicitly, as the old mode is deprecated and will be removed in 5.0. Conflict callbacks now fire once per event pair instead of per field. The shipped default configuration is as follows.

service settings:
[casax]
port = 6379
team = rusir
host = casax.zemvarhq.corp
region = outer-4
access_code = ac_9808ce
timeout_ms = 1500